| Functional Responsibility: |
Assists and works under the direction of senior analysts. Supports programming efforts and assists in designing, coding, testing and debugging systems software. Confers with customers and coworkers involved to analyze current operational needs, identify problems, and learn specific input and output requirements such as forms of data input, how data is to be summarized, and formats of reports. Maintains and modifies complex systems such as inventory control, accounting systems, fire control, command and control systems, communications management systems, or multi-user/multi-site systems in which complex automated processes are conducted. Assists users in developing requirements and carries out customer needs assessments. |